What Is a Snapstreak?

If you’re looking to learn what’s behind the hourglass symbol, you must first understand the way Snapstreaks function.

When you exchange a photo with an other user at least once in at minimum three consecutive days, you’ll be able to start an Snapstreak. In the event of this an emoji with a fire symbol will be displayed next to the username.

To keep the streak going, you’ll need to swap photos at least once each day for 24 hours. Be aware that both of you have to share photos to keep the streak going. This can be a fun method to motivate users to use the app regularly.

Additionally, you will see an additional number beside the fire emoji. This will display the days that your streak has gone on. If you don’t swap snaps for 24 hours in a row, the streak will come to an end and the fire emoji will vanish.

What Does the Hourglass Emoji Mean?

To remind you of the 24-hour Snapstreak timer coming at an end Snapchat displays an hourglass-shaped emoji alongside the fire Emoji.

If you aren’t quick sufficient when you encounter this emoticon, your streak could come to an end. What is your time?

If the Snapstreak timer has reached the 20 10th hour after your last snap exchange the hourglass icon will be displayed. This means you and your companion will have approximately four hours to keep the streak going until it’s over.

If you’d like the hourglass emoji to vanish it is possible to swap snaps immediately or let the streak run out.

What Is the 100 Icon Next to a Snapstreak?

The “100” icon that appears next to the user’s name indicates that you’ve been able to exchange pictures with that person for a hundred days. In recognition of this exemplary commitment, Snapchat will award you with a ‘100’ emoticon to commemorate your Snapstreak.

The icon will vanish at the 101st day of your birthday regardless of whether you decide to keep the streak or end it.

How to Maintain a Snapstreak

In order to keep your streak going, you need to share snaps. However it is not the case that all types of interactions via Snapchat can be considered as snaps.

Snaps are short messages you create with your camera. This means that images as well as video recordings count towards your Snapstreak however text and voice messages don’t.

Other actions that do not count toward the Snapstreak are:

  • Snapchat Stories
  • Spectacles
  • Memories
  • Group Chats

What to Do if Your Snapstreak Disappears?

If your Snapstreak was gone, even though the user and friend have sent snaps the app may have a glitch. have occurred.

If you think that your Snapstreak disappeared because of a error, you are able to:

  1. Visit the Snapchat Support page.
  2. Look for the ‘My Snapstreak disappeared option.
  3. Complete the required information.

Once you’ve completed this process then you’ll have to wait until Support gets back to you and assist you solve your problem. After you have received a message returned Snapchat will clarify the rules to keep you on your Snap Streak.
